Output 075ea28f1927a571dbc7646aa72caa34e484927708f8857de7ea2fcd0f964595:3

value
170878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18834d3f8a95c75f85848990785fe13ad8ca01a OP_EQUAL
address
3NFX8VLU8sGTBMkdaLVk13PpvnBJL5ktsd
transaction
075ea28f1927a571dbc7646aa72caa34e484927708f8857de7ea2fcd0f964595
spent
true